*UPDATE: Grace has now been found*

A mum has issued an urgent plea as her daughter, from Skelmersdale, has not been seen for six days.

Grace Ditchfield, 16, has not been seen since last Tuesday, July 16.

Her mum Caitriona Marsh is concerned for her welfare and says she has no clean clothes or money.

Caitriona said she left home at around 11am on July 16 and said she was going to stay at a friend’s house.

On Wednesday, Caitriona spoke to her on the phone. She has since made phone calls and sent text messages to loved ones but is yet to return home or reveal where she is.

The last known text message sent from Grace’s phone was sent on Sunday (July 21).

Caitriona said: “I last spoke to her on Wednesday evening I was trying to ask her where she was but she kept repeating the same sentence to me which was 'mum, I am safe'.

“I want her to know that she is not in any trouble. I just want to know where she is and if she is with anyone.

“If anyone knows where she is, or if she is with you, please let someone know. You can message me or contact Skelmersdale Police.”

Grace has hazel eyes, dark blonde hair, a distinctive mole on the palm of one of her hands and she is around 5ft5.
